FBI Limited by U.S. Supreme Court GPS Decision, Mueller Says
By Seth Stern -
2012-03-07T16:10:30Z
A U.S. Supreme Court decision limiting police power to track people using GPS devices will “inhibit” the Federal Bureau of Investigation’s ability to use them in probes, said Robert Mueller, the agency’s director.
“It will inhibit our ability to use this in a number of surveillances where it has been tremendously beneficial,” Mueller said today in testimony to a U.S. House Appropriations subcommittee when asked about the Supreme Court’s January decision.
